About this farm stay rental

Situated within 21 km of Bloukrans Bridge and 29 km of Robberg Nature Reserve in Plettenberg Bay, Tenikwa Wildlife Centre provides accommodation with seating area. The property has mountain and lake views, and is 19 km from Goose Valley Golf Club.

My heart is in Tenikwa
The accomodation was spacoius and clean, we stayed in the main house and two bedroom guest house, we were 7 guests. We took half board, breakfast and dinner were delicious, the cook informed us everyday of the meal he is going to prepare and if we have any special requests. A fire was lit every evening, in the Boma near the cheetah inclosure. The staff we amazing, helping us out with everything we needed. Went on a long private tour, which was very informative and were able to get amazing pictures, the guide was very friendly and knowledgeable, he was also very patient and accomodating with all our photography requests. You can't get touch the animals any more due to new laws, but we were able to get amazing pictures. We heard the lions calling and was amazing to walk around the property and enjoy nature. We have been here a few times and make an effort to come and visit Tenikwa each time we are in SA. I highly recommend this place, the staff sre amazing, the facilities are clean and spacious, good food and close to monkeyland, birds of eden and other places. Great location. Thank you for a wonderful stay.
No heating in the rooms, was a bit cold, but they did supply extra blankets. Which kept us warm at night.
